Multi-sensor and algorithm fusion improving precision for material dealing with robots
throughout the dynamic setting of lithium battery workshops, wherever various stages operate in parallel less than stringent problems, precision becomes paramount. Robot brands specializing in industry robotic remedies have built-in multi-sensor arrays and State-of-the-art algorithm fusion into their transport robots, significantly increasing precision and trustworthiness. By combining knowledge from lidar, cameras, and power sensors, these robots can navigate complicated layouts and modify movements in real-time. This amalgamation of sensory inputs helps sustain reliable positioning Irrespective of environmental interferences like dust or static electrical energy, which might be typical in battery production amenities. Additionally, algorithm fusion enhances conclusion-earning algorithms, making it possible for robots to respond swiftly to unexpected hurdles or variations in workflow. This significant amount of precision don't just safeguards pricey products but also supports tighter scheduling and greater coordination in between production phases. transportation robots makers who definitely have prioritized sensory and computational breakthroughs supply necessary applications for factories aiming to attain superior-throughput, error-free of charge functions.
Addressing environmental problems with purposeful robots in corrosive, dust-evidence circumstances
Lithium battery generation environments existing significant issues to automation owing towards the corrosive character of acid and alkali gases, combined with pervasive dust as well as the existence of sensitive Digital factors. useful robots manufacturers have responded by engineering transport robots Outfitted with components and coatings resistant to chemical corrosion and static Make-up.
